VIVAnews – Commission VII of the House of Representatives (DPR), represented by the Minister of Energy & Mineral Resources, has agreed to add another Rp24.52 trillion electricity subsidy to the 2012 Revised State Budget.
“So, the total subsidy for electricity reaches Rp24.52 trillion,” said Chairman of Commission VII, Teuku Rifki Pasha, in a Coordinating Meeting with the Minister of Energy & Mineral Resources at the House of Representatives in Jakarta, on Thursday.
Therefore, the total approved electricity subsidy for the 2012 Revised State Budget will be Rp64.97 trillion. “The Rp24.52 trillion is added to the figure in the 2012 State Budget of Rp40.45 trillion,” said Rifki.
Rifki said the additional subsidy comprises the adjustment of commercial operation date (COD), coal, maintenance and other operational expense cut of Rp7.61 trillion; ICP increment of Rp4.70 trillion; diesel and genset rental increment of Rp3.29 trillion; electricity purchase from fixed IPP increment of Rp1.40 trillion; and loan interest expense cut of Rp2.48 trillion.
As for the supply of gas and decrease of electricity sales revenue, the Commission VII agreed to bring the number down to zero.
